Introduction:Triple negative breast cancer constituting 10-20% of all breast cancers, and are more frequently in younger patients with poor prognostic outcome , The tumor microenvironment is formed of activated fibroblasts which known as Cancer associated fibroblasts, which can be detected by fibroblast activation protein [FAP] and α-smooth muscle actin [α-SMA].Aim of the work: evaluation of the expression and distribution of FAP and α-SMA in triple negative breast cancer.Material and methods: this study was carried on 100 paraffin blocks from pathologically proved triple negative invasive breast cancer patients and subjected to immunostaining of SMA and FAP antibodies, Evaluation of antibodies expression according to its distribution in tumor margin and in tumor center.Results: There were significant differences between FAP as well as SMA expression in tumor center and tumor margin, FAP and SMA expression in the tumor center was positively correlated with tumor size and grade.In contrast to tumor margin FAP and SMA expression was negative correlated with tumor size and lymph node metastasis. Conclusion:We speculated that high FAP expression and α-SMA expression in the tumor center, but not the tumor margin, is correlated with poor patient's clinicopathological parameter.
